The Marvel Cinematic Universe has been busy with a lot of developments lately, all concerning the Avengers, Thor, Captain America, and now Spider-Man. So where does the Hulk a.k.a Dr. Bruce Banner fit into all of their plans?

The actor who plays Hulk, Mark Ruffalo said that it is quite possible that the huge green superhero will get another solo movie soon.

In an interview with Empire, Ruffalo said that the dynamic between Banner and Hulk might evolve, there prompting a new Hulk solo movie.

"Who knows where these things will go," Rufallo said. "But as Bruce is able to impress his will on the Hulk - going into The Hulk and being inside the Hulk when he's raging -  The Hulk's will is also growing and able to impress upon Bruce. It'll be interesting to see if that ends up being what would be the next Hulk movie."

The first two Hulk movies produced by Marvel were considered flops, so they are in no rush in creating a new one soon out of fear that it might flop again. Ruffalo agreed, saying that it would be very redundant to keep on highlighting Banner's personal struggles with the Hulk.

"A new feaure-length Hulk movie is a tough nut to crack. Traditionally you're watching a guy who doesn't want to do the very thing that you want him to do. It's hard to take for two hours. I don't know how many times you can use that same framing for it, but now he's maturing and there's a cool dynamic growing between Banner and The Hulk," he said.

Ruffalo keeps saying that the new dynamic will be seen in the new movie Avengers: Age of Ultron, which is slated for release on May 1.

According to the actor, the character of Banner has matured since the previous Avengers movie, and Hulk has grown more accustomed working with the team. Ruffalo even teased that every character in the new Avengers movie "has their own cool little thing happening."

And because the CGI is so much better now, the Hulk will be able to do a real performance and impress the audience more, he said.

"I've been working with Andy Serkis at his Imaginarium studio and he has it set up where you go in there and you just start working on a character. It is so exciting to me, because I can do whatever I can imagine, with a team of people of course," shared Ruffalo.
